Becoming a Certified Professional in Gender Inclusive Urban Development equips professionals with the knowledge and skills to champion equitable urban planning and design. The program fosters a deep understanding of gender dynamics within urban spaces and empowers participants to create inclusive environments.
Learning outcomes for the Certified Professional in Gender Inclusive Urban Development certification include the ability to analyze gender inequalities in urban contexts, develop gender-sensitive urban policies, and implement inclusive urban projects. Participants gain proficiency in participatory methodologies and data collection techniques specific to gender analysis. This also includes understanding and applying relevant legislation and international best practices concerning gender equality in urban development.
